Y EREVAN, NOVEMBER 15, ARMENPRESS: In the result of the cooperation between the Ombudsmen of the Republic of Armenia and Republic of Nagorno Karabakh European Ombudsman Institute spread a statement yesterday, by which it denied the misinformation in the website of Azerbaijan’s Ombudsman on the incident taken place at the course of the conference in the city of Innsbruck, Austria. “Armenpress” was informed about it from the staff of Human RightsDefender of the Republic of Armenia.

At the course of the conference devoted to the 25th anniversary of the European Ombudsman Institute which was held in Innsbruck city of Austria in September, the representative of Azerbaijan’s Ombudsman (the Ombudsman was absent) after the speech of Human Rights Defender of Artsakh Yuri Hayrapetyan, asked for a speech complaining for the participation of the Ombudsman of the Republic of Nagorno-Karabakh.

After the incident, apparent misinformation was placed in the official website of the Ombudsman of Azerbaijan as if Yuri Hayrapetyan had been removed from the conference after the speech of the representative of Azerbaijan’s Ombudsman.
